Best practice in cardiac anesthesia during the COVID-19 pandemic: Practical recommendations

This review highlights safe cardiac anesthesia practices during the COVID-19 pandemic. It emphasizes patient prioritization, respiratory assessment, and protective measures for confirmed or suspected cases to ensure team and operating room integrity.

Main Results:

  • Cardiac surgery timing should be prioritized based on individual patient needs, with potential postponement advised.
  • Preanesthetic evaluation must focus on respiratory status, treating all emergency surgery patients as potentially infectious.
  • Specific protocols for confirmed or suspected COVID-19 patients include draping equipment and strict adherence to guidelines to maintain operating room integrity.

Conclusions:

  • Careful patient prioritization and thorough respiratory assessment are vital for safe cardiac anesthesia during the pandemic.
  • Implementing stringent protective measures and following international guidelines are essential for managing COVID-19-positive or suspected cardiac surgery patients.
